IN LOVING MEMORY OF
James "Jim" J.
Weinfurter
March 28, 1950 – September 6, 2025
James J. Weinfurter Sr., 75, of the Town of Wood passed away unexpectedly of a heart attack whilst completing his chores the morning of Saturday, September 6, 2025.
A Mass of Christian Burial for Jim will be 11:00am on Wednesday, September 10th at St. Joachim Catholic Church in Pittsville. Burial will follow in the parish cemetery. Visitation for relatives and friends will be from 9am until the time of Mass at church. Buchanan/Rembs Funeral Home is assisting the family.
Jim was born March 28, 1950 at home in Pittsville to Edward and Mary (Redmond) Weinfurter. He attended school in Pittsville, graduating in 1969. He was the first wrestler from Pittsville High to make it to state. Jim married the former Miss Sally Ann Juedes January 16, 1971 at Sacred Heart Church in Stetsonville, WI. They had just celebrated 54 years together.
Jim was an incredibly talented mechanic and welder. He had worked maintenance for Schwanebeck Trucking and Foremost Farms. Following his retirement he took much enjoyment helping on the day to day at his son's farm driving tractor and fixing equipment. He loved spending time with his sons and grandchildren hunting. He is a past president of the Lil' Bullmobilers Snowmobile Club of Pittsville.
